The IV Bag market is a segment of the medical device industry that focuses on the production and distribution of intravenous (IV) bags. These bags are used to deliver fluids, medications, and nutrients directly into a patient's bloodstream. IV bags are typically made of plastic and come in a variety of sizes and shapes. They are designed to be used with a variety of IV administration sets, such as catheters, needles, and tubing. The IV Bag market is highly competitive, with a wide range of products available from different manufacturers.
The IV Bag market is driven by the increasing demand for medical devices, as well as the need for improved patient safety and comfort. The market is also influenced by technological advancements, such as the development of new materials and the introduction of new features.
